Abstract:
We report on thermal, spectroscopic, and laser properties of transparent 5 at.% Tm 3+ -doped yttria and “mixed” yttria-scandia ceramics fabricated by vacuum sintering at 1750°C using nanoparticles produced by laser ablation. The solid-solution (Tm 0.05 Y 0.698 Sc 0.252 ) 2 O 3 ceramic features a broadband emission extending up to 2.3 µm (gain bandwidth, 167 nm) and high thermal conductivity of 4.48 W m −1 K −1 . A Tm:Y 2 O 3 ceramic laser generated 812 mW at 2.05 µm with a slope efficiency η of 70.2%. For the Tm:(Y,Sc) 2 O 3 ceramic, the output power was 523 mW at 2.09 µm with η = 44.7%. These results represent record-high slope efficiencies for any parent or “mixed” Tm 3+ -doped sesquioxide ceramics.
